Weather in December

The first month of the winter, December, is also a moderately hot month in Cobá, Mexico, with an average temperature fluctuating between 27.6°C (81.7°F) and 22.2°C (72°F).

Temperature

The arrival of December brings an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 27.6°C (81.7°F), subtly diverging from November's 28.5°C (83.3°F). During December, Cobá records a consistent average nighttime temperature of 22.2°C (72°F).

Heat index

December's heat index is estimated at a hot 31°C (87.8°F). Remaining active during long-lasting exposure could cause fatigue, leading to heat cramps.
Data suggests that the heat index is set for environments in shade and with a light wind. The heat index could see an incre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ees under direct sunshine.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', arises from combining readings of air temperature and relative moisture content. The impact of weather on an individual can be subjective, affected by the person's activity and heat perception, which can vary due to elements including wind, clothing, and metabolic differences. Direct sun rays can make one feel hotter,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ely vital to babies and toddlers. Children frequently underestimate the necessity to rest and hydrate. Thirst is a late sign of dehydration - thus, it is vital to stay hydrated, particularly during lengthy physical exercises.

Humidity

In Cobá, Mexico, the average relative humidity in December is 78%.

Rainfall

In Cobá, in December, during 18.5 rainfall days, 47mm (1.85")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Cobá, during the entire year, the rain falls for 210.8 days and collects up to 810mm (31.89") of precipitation.

Daylight

December has the shortest days of the year, with an average of 10h and 54min of daylight.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:10 am and sunset at 6:09 pm. On the last day of December, sunrise is at 7:26 am and sunset at 6:21 pm EST.

Sunshine

In Cobá, the average sunshine in December is 8.4h.

UV index

January, February,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 6 in December interprets into the following recommendations:
Stick with precautions and abide by sun safety procedures. Evading sunburn is essential. Stay out of direct sunlight and seek shade between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is strongest, but remember that shade devices may not offer full sun protection. Sun-protective clothing, a long-sleeved shirt and pants, a wide-brimmed hat, and UVA and UVB-blocking sunglasses are particularly helpful in blocking UV radiation's harmful effects.
